The White-Label ERP model creates multiple entry points for technology partners:
| Partner Type | Opportunity |
|---|---|
| ERP Consultants | Implementation and optimization services |
| IT Consulting Firms | Reseller + managed ERP services |
| SaaS Startups | Embed ERP into vertical SaaS products |
| Cloud Service Providers | ERP bundled with cloud advisory services |
| System Integrators | Enterprise integrations and digital transformation programs |
White-labeling enables full brand control, creating long-term client ownership and recurring revenue streams.
